Tony Pollard, the running back for the Tennessee Titans, is dealing with a foot injury that caused him to miss practice on Thursday. Despite this, he had a strong performance in the previous game against the Patriots, showcasing his importance in the Titans' offense. With Tyjae Spears ruled out for the upcoming game against the Bills, Pollard is expected to take on a significant workload.
- Pollard's foot injury raises concerns, but his absence from practice may be maintenance-related.
- Pollard has been a consistent performer, averaging at least 85 yards from scrimmage in four of five games this season.
- With Spears out, Pollard is set to be the primary back against the Bills.
